Job description

Etegent is seeking a Cloud Engineer to help maintain and sustain software, services, and development environments on large-scale computing systems to benefit our Department of Defense (DoD) and Intelligence Community (IC) customers. This opportunity is particularly focused on the implementation, management, maintenance, and security compliance, and documentation of virtual desktop infrastructure (VDI). This position is primarily on-site at government facilities at Wright Patterson Air Force Base, along with some time in our Dayton office., * Implement and maintain virtual desktop infrastructure (VDI) using platforms such as Azure Virtual Desktops, AWS Workspaces, or Horizon Virtual Desktops.

  • Develop, push, and test operating system configurations to thin-client devices.
  • Administer security patches, manages SSL/TLS certificates, and other tasks related to ensuring secure access to VDI systems.
  • Work with users to pilot changes to infrastructure, gather performance metrics, and refine changes based on feedback.
  • Collaborate with Information System Security Officers (ISSOs) to maintain security compliance and monitoring for all systems.
  • Writing clear, concise documentation for system architecture or for operational guides to support helpdesk personnel.
